Cable One (CABO) came out with a quarterly loss of $1.35 per share versus the Zacks Consensus Estimate of $7.6. This compares to earnings of $1.53 per share a year ago.

Cable One (CABO) came out with quarterly earnings of $3.23 per share, missing the Zacks Consensus Estimate of $8.23 per share. This compares to earnings of $8.16 per share a year ago.
Cable One is undervalued at 1.32x FWD cash flow, with strong free cash flow and ongoing stock repurchases supporting a Buy rating. Deployment of DOCSIS 4.0, fiber investments, and growth in remote work and IoT are expected to drive user and revenue growth. Recent declines in contract termination costs and potential U.S. tax cuts could act as catalysts for stock price appreciation.
